Cover the dish with foil. Bake information technology for a good thirty minutes to get the potatoes started. Subsequently 30 minutes, remove the foil and keep baking for twenty minutes, or until the tiptop is golden and bubbly.

Image (27) 4265361021_4c8bd5f9b6_o.jpg for post 11483

This looks about right! The top is golden brown, and the dish is bubbling all over. (If the twenty minutes doesn't practise the play a joke on, simply upwardly this phase by five or 10 minutes. You want to make certain the whole dish is very hot and bubbly—this ways the potatoes are really getting the gamble to get done.)
